Tips for Getting the Best Price on Health Insurance

health insurance quotes for small business There are a few things small business owners can do to get the best price on health insurance for their employees. Here are a few tips:

1. Get quotes from multiple insurers. This will help you compare prices and coverage options to find the best plan for your needs.

2. Consider a high deductible plan. These plans have lower monthly premiums, but higher out-of-pocket costs if your employees need to use their health insurance.

3. Ask about discounts. Many insurers offer discounts for small businesses that meet certain criteria, such as having a healthy workforce or offering wellness programs.

4. Shop around each year. Health insurance rates can change from year to year, so it’s important to compare prices every time your policy comes up for renewal.

Alternatives to Traditional Health Insurance Plans

There are a number of alternatives to traditional health insurance plans available for small businesses. These include:

1. Health Savings Accounts (HSAs) – HSAs are tax-advantaged accounts that can be used to pay for qualified medical expenses. Contributions to an HSA are made with pretax dollars, and withdrawals for qualified medical expenses are tax-free.

2. Health Reimbursement Arrangements (HRAs) – HRAs are employer-funded accounts that reimburse employees for out-of-pocket medical expenses. Like HSAs, HRAs offer a tax advantage, as contributions are made with pretax dollars and withdrawals for qualified medical expenses are tax-free.

3. Self-Insured Health Plans – Self-insured health plans are funded by the employer, but the risk of claims is borne by the employer rather than an insurance company. These plans often offer more flexibility in terms of coverage and benefits than traditional health insurance plans.

4. Limited Benefit Plans – Limited benefit plans provide basic coverage for things like hospitalization and doctor visits, but may not cover other types of care such as prescription drugs or mental health services. These plans typically have lower premiums than comprehensive health insurance plans, but will also pay out less in benefits if you need to make a claim.
